Steve Looney Makes Notable Speaking Tour Across U.S.

Dean Mead’s Chair of the Tax and Corporate department, Stephen R. Looney, speaks frequently throughout the country and his speaking tour is especially busy this year with 10 stops in seven cities. A list of dates, locations and presentation topics is provided below.

Mr. Looney is the chair of the Tax & Corporate department at Dean Mead in Orlando. He represents clients in a variety of business and tax matters including entity formation (S and C corporations, partnerships, and LLCs), acquisitions, dispositions, redemptions, liquidations, reorganizations, tax-free exchanges of real estate and tax controversies. His clients include closely held businesses, with an emphasis on medical and other professional services practices. He is a member of the Board of Trustees of the Southern Federal Tax Institute, as well as former Chair of the S Corporations Committee of the American Bar Association’s Tax Section.
